Ashburton

(From our own correspondent.) May 26. The weekly meeting of the Catholic Young Men’s Club was held on last Wednesday evening, the president (Mr. I/. J. Ryan) presiding. Five new members were elected. I ho programme for the evening consisted of musical items, each member being called upon to contribute ,or else forfeit 1/- to the social fund; the latter did not benefit to a great extent, as practically eVerv member responded. The winter “at home ’ socials under the auspices of the club commence on next Wednesday evening. The fortnightly meeting of the St. Patrick’s branch of the Hibernian Society was held last Monday evening, the president (Mr. E. J. Kelleher) presiding. Two new members were nominated, and one initiated by the president. Correspondence was received from the district executive, and dealt with. After business had been concluded members present spent a social hour in cards.
